    Cool bike and I’m glad that you get to charge at home; that said one thing that bugs me about ALL evs is this emphasis on home charging. Idk a thing about life in New Zealand but in the USA outside of a few places that are brand new construction, apartments don’t have chargers, rental houses aren’t really going to allow you to install a charger unless the landlord wants to go green and to get a charger installed from what I understand is between 3-10k depending on many factors. I guess my point is, it annoys me that ev compañía place this emphasis on home charging when the reality is few people have the ability or access to it.
    That said, 1. It has to start somewhere I get that and 2. If I had to go buy an ev right now today, an enérgica would be it hands down.

    • @NewZeroland
      @NewZeroland  2 ปีที่แล้ว

      Yeah I understand, for sure. Apartment living is limited, and you'd have to really want an EV to use a public charger. Some people are able to charge for free at work, so they never charge at home. We used normal wall sockets to charge everything (slow but whatever) and just bought a faster 32A wall pod a month ago. It was about $1,500 for the charger and installation. I can't imagine spending more than that. So I guess an extension cord out the window is a possible work-around for people with interesting living situations, or removable batteries that you can charge inside without hauling the whole bike upstairs.
